Public Sector People are partnering with a local council in Melbourne’s northern suburbs to recruit an experienced Administration Officer to join the Maternal Child Health Department.
Hourly Rate: $37 per hour + super
Hours: 38 hours per week
Duration: ASAP start until 31st October 2025
Working Arrangement: Hybrid
As an Administration Officer, you will play a key role in supporting Maternal and Child Health services through timely and accurate administrative assistance. This includes handling client enquiries, scheduling appointments, managing data entry, and maintaining confidentiality in all client and council records.
Key responsibilities include:
- Deliver prompt and professional customer service to internal and external stakeholders using Maternal and Child Health (MCH) services
- Manage scheduling of client appointments across multiple MCH centres using council systems
- Respond to telephone and email enquiries efficiently
- Contribute to process improvements and uphold compliance with council policies and procedures
- Proven experience in high-volume administrative roles
- Knowledge of overall Maternal and Child Health Services
- Experience using Microsoft Office and other business software; familiarity with council systems (such as CDIS or similar) is advantageous
- Experience in making appointments within a customer service environment
- A collaborative and flexible approach to supporting team-based services
